Virtual Initiation?!

AL Epsilon conducted the first online initiation in the history of Tau Beta Pi on Monday, March 23, as a dozen people were initiated into the Alabama Epsilon Chapter at the University of South Alabama. The initiation team consisted of the following members: Nicholas B. Naylor, AL E ’20, Outgoing AL E President; Curtis D. Gomulinski, MI E ’01, TBP Executive Director; John W. Steadman, WY A ’64, USA Dean Emeritus; Sally J. Steadman, WY A ’69, Chapter Chief Advisor; Edward J. D’Avignon, NY B ’98, TBP Director of Rituals; Steven P. Klepac, AL E ’21, Incoming AL E President.
Information about conducting an online initiation will be provided to the collegiate chapters on April 1, 2020.
